If a polygon has n sides, the sum of the interior angles is 180(n-2). In this case, it's 180(6-2) = 180*4 = 720

It is a hexagon, a 6-sided polygon. The formula for the sum of interior angles in an n-sided polygon is 180(n-2). When 720 = 180 (n-2) 4 = n-2 n = 6
